D H Lowenstein is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Physiology and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, D H Lowenstein has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Molecular Biology, 3 papers in Physiology and 2 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in D H Lowenstein’s work include Heat shock proteins research (2 papers), Neonatal and fetal brain pathology (2 papers) and Hemophilia Treatment and Research (1 paper). D H Lowenstein is often cited by papers focused on Heat shock proteins research (2 papers), Neonatal and fetal brain pathology (2 papers) and Hemophilia Treatment and Research (1 paper). D H Lowenstein collaborates with scholars based in United States. D H Lowenstein's co-authors include Kinya Hisanaga, Pak H. Chan, Michael F. Miles, Roger P. Simon, John W. Engstrom, Dale E. Bredesen, Stephen D. Collins, Stephen M. Massa, Michael C. Rowbotham and Howard E. McKinney and has published in prestigious journals such as Neuron, Journal of Neuroscience and Molecular and Cellular Biology.
